Furthermore, if ya ask Sarah, the Dems are going down a “dangerous, dangerous road” in requesting Trump’s tax documents — which they did, formally, earlier this month.

Ways and Means Committee Chairman Richard Neal’s led the way, asking IRS Commissioner Charles Rettig for over six years’ worth of The Donald’s dealings.

On Saturday, the chairman sent a 2nd letter, extending the deadline to April 23rd.

But guess what, Dems? The Artist of the Deal has said he won’t release ’em — he’s currently in the midst of an audit.

If Trump changes his mind, Congress’ll have some help goin’ through ’em.

The Hill reports:

If the House Ways and Means Committee obtains Trump’s tax returns, it could designate committee staff and staff from Congress’s Joint Committee on Taxation to help review the tax returns behind closed doors before the committee votes to make any of the returns public.
